Abstrakt

Remote sensing is one of the most widely used methods of acquiring spatial data describing the Earth's surface, which is associated with subsequent data analysis and processing. Most often, the imagery was obtained using an aeroplane or satellite as a sensor carrier, but due to technological advances, un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) are increasingly used. UAVs provide very-high spatial resolution data. Multimedia tools are essential during the whole processing and visualization procedure. The paper demonstrates that UAV-borne RGB data can be successfully used to detect water surface, bare land and vegetation as key land cover types. Both supervised and unsupervised classification methods are used.
